Methods and compositions for producing siRNAs, e.g., in the form of a
d-siRNA composition, from dsRNAs are provided. In the subject methods, a
dsRNA is contacted with a composition that includes an activity that
cleaves dsRNA into siRNAs, where the composition efficiently cleaves
dsRNA into siRNAs. siRNAs produced by the subject methods find use in a
variety of applications, particularly in applications where the specific
reduction or silencing of a gene is desired. Also provided are kits for
use in practicing the subject invention.
